The name Deen has multiple origins and rich cultural significance across various traditions. Primarily, it derives from the Arabic word 'dīn' (دين), which refers to 'religion,' 'faith,' or 'way of life.' In Islamic contexts, Deen represents adherence to the divine path or religious obligations. The name carries connotations of devotion, spiritual righteousness, and moral integrity.
In Western traditions, Deen can also function as a variant of the name Dean, which has Anglo-Saxon origins from the Old English 'denu,' meaning 'valley.' Historically, 'Dean' was an occupational surname for someone who served as a dean in ecclesiastical settings or academic institutions. As a given name, Deen has gained popularity as both a standalone name and as a shortened form of names like Deangelo or Nadeen. The name's concise form and meaningful heritage have contributed to its enduring appeal across different cultures.
Deen is a versatile name with presence in both the United States and the United Kingdom. While it appears in records for both male and female individuals in the US, it is predominantly used for males in the UK. Despite its multicultural appeal, Deen hasn't ranked among the most popular names in recent statistical data from either country.

The name Deen has diverse origins and appears in various cultural contexts, leading to multiple spelling variants across different regions and traditions. In Arabic culture, Deen (sometimes spelled as Din) means 'religion' or 'way of life' and is often found in phrases like 'Ad-Deen' or combined in names like Noorudeen, meaning 'light of religion.' In Western contexts, Deen often serves as a shortened form of names like Deangelo or Deanne. Other common variants include Dean, which is the more prevalent English spelling, alongside less common forms like Deene or Deyn. In some South Asian communities, Deen can also appear as Deenanath or Deenabandhu, where it maintains its connection to spiritual significance.
